Well, it was finally time for me to cook (once every 15 months) and i made my specialty.
Started out by stuffing pork tenderloin with smoked oysters and minced garlic and then off to the fridge to marinate. Attachment 55198 Attachment 55199 Had time for some Canebreak while getting ready for the wild rice pilaf and sweet potatoe casserole. Also therew together a spinach salad with fresh strawberries, walnuts and feta cheese. Attachment 55201 Then it is off to the pit for some grill time. Once it was just about complete, i drizzle the tenderloin with Steens cane syrup and top with fresh cracked pepper. Attachment 55202 Attachment 55203 End result! OUTSTANDING!
